有关定义变量的问题,很简单,谢谢!


我在一个例程开始看到有这样定义的变量:
......
start_msg db 0ah, 0dh, 'RUN', 0ah, 0dh, '$'
end_msg db 0ah, 0dh, 'END', 0ah, 0dh, '$'
.....

我不明白直接定义成:
......
start_msg db 'RUN'
end_msg db 'END'
.....

不行吗? 0ah, 0bh, '$' 有什么作用呢?
[357 byte] By [cd7809-流浪] at [2007-12-16]
# 1
0ah-换行符
0dh-回车
"$"-用INT 21H的9号功能的字符串结束标志。

另:你把它们去掉就知道它们的用处了。:)
Areslee-懒虫易水 at 2007-10-21 > top of Msdn China Tech,其他开发语言,汇编语言...
# 2

非常感谢!
cd7809-流浪 at 2007-10-21 > top of Msdn China Tech,其他开发语言,汇编语言...